Hey everyone! I'm a long time MK4 VW guy, and I recently bought a 2000 beetle. The car is a silver 2.0 with a 5-speed. It's got a severe crack in the trans case. I gave $200 for it with 114,000 miles on it. The interior is … UHG … but will clean up. It also needs interior door panels and a driver's side window regulator. Engine runs very nicely, and the trans actually shifts through all gears like normal and moves around my yard just fine. I put new plugs in it today, and noticed that there is no SAI pump. I mean no pump, no pump bracket, no harness connector, no hoses, and no empty holes in the air box. What's going on? Didn't all beetles have SAI systems? Did you check the vin # and confirm the year? I have heard some of the early models: not having a sai system? I've heard of this before but never seen this myself, however (saw no sai system on a 98 audi a4 1.8T i worked on, though). This may not be the case but it's definitely something to look for and research to see if it is on your new beetlel! Note: early new beetle's shared some parts with the previous generation Mark III Golfs/Jettas (engines, shifter boxes etc.).
Hello! Yes, everything checks out with the VIN etc... It is an AEG, and has the later model MK4 shift tower. This car just didn't have any SAI system.
